Our Glasgow based Maritime client require a HR Systems Analyst to join them on their vision to become “Powered by Digital” and enhance their HR service delivery with an agile HR team that can provide added value to the company.  As HR Systems Analyst, you will place a large focus on HR technology and data to aid the company in achieving this goal, providing ongoing support, maintenance, and updates to the new Human Capital Management (HCM) system, Oracle HCM.
 
In addition, as HR Systems Analyst, you will be responsible for producing and using data from the HCM to work with the business to deliver meaningful, accurate, and timely HR analytics, KPIs, reports and dashboards that will support data-driven decisions.

JOB DESCRIPTION
  • Be the global system administrator for Oracle HCM.
  • Manage the quarterly release/updates process, including regression testing, tracking bugs, updating user guides, and communicating changes to stakeholders.
  • Liaise with consultants from Oracle HCM AMS team.
  • Educate stakeholders on enhancement opportunities and process improvements through new functionality delivered during system updates.
  • Analyse user requirements by working closely with internal teams to gather requirements, design, build, test, and deploy HCM functionality and processes for existing and new modules.
  • System configuration and testing.
  • Develop/customize reports and prepare data that support HCM, people analytics, and other areas as needed.
  • Maintain and update system documentation, including business process documentation, HR User Guides, and Employee User Guides.
  • Provide continuous improvement by reviewing business processes to identify/recommend new business processes and requirements.
  • Be the key liaison between HR, Payroll, Finance, and IT for the successful delivery of HR technology and data.
  • Support the coordination/implementation of future HR technology needs, additional HCM modules and/or data requirements.
  • Ensure HR data integrity and compliance with global data privacy and data protection guidelines.
  • Manage other HR Systems, such as Shareworks and Cloudpay integration with HCM.
  • Support with the exploration of alternative HCM systems to best fit with Company business needs.
